1980 Mazda 323 vs. 2006 Toyota Tazz

To start off, 2006 Toyota Tazz is newer by 26 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1980 Mazda 323.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1980 Mazda 323 would be higher. At 1,490 cc (4 cylinders), 1980 Mazda 323 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, both vehicles can yield 74 horse power. So under normal driving conditions, the acceleration of both vehicles should be relatively similar.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2006 Toyota Tazz weights approximately 475 kg more than 1980 Mazda 323.

Let's talk about torque, 1980 Mazda 323 (116 Nm @ 3000 RPM) has 13 more torque (in Nm) than 2006 Toyota Tazz. (103 Nm @ 4200 RPM). This means 1980 Mazda 323 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2006 Toyota Tazz.
